ARTI CLE X XIV The said Commission may make agreements with bondholders as to the deposit of its funds, and the security to be required there- for, and as to the withdrawal and disbursement thereof . Subject to s uch a greem ents, the Commi ssion shal l pro vide for d eposi t of its funds, security to be required therefor and the withdrawal and disbursement thereof, and if required by the Commission its de- posits shall be secured and all banks and trust companies are hereby authorized to give such security for such deposits . AR TicLE XXV The construction of Rouses Point Bridge shall be by contract or several contracts made and executed in the same manner as provided in article 19 hereof for the contract for the construction of the bridge heretofore constructed by the Commission . The approaches may in the discretion of the Commission be constructed by its own employees . ARTI CLE X XVI 1 . Such Commission shall have power and is hereby authorized from time to time to issue its negotiable bonds, in addition to those issued prior to the 1st day of March 1933, for any corpo- rate purpose in the aggregate principal amount of not exceeding $1,000,0 00 . 2. Said bonds shall be authorized by resolution of such Commis- sion and shall bear such date or dates, mature at such time or times, not exceeding fifty years from their respective dates, bear interest at such rate or rates, not exceeding 5 per centum per annum payable semiannually, be in such denomina tions, be in such form, either coupon or registered, carry such registration privi- leges, be executed in such manner, be payable in such medium of payment, at such place or places, and be subject to such terms of redemption, not exceeding par and accrued interest, as such reso- lution or resolutions may provide . Said bonds may be sold at public or private sale for such price or prices as such Commission shall determine : P ro vi de d, That the interest cost to m aturity of the money received for any issue of said bonds shall not exceed 5 per c entum per annum . 3.
